Boeing 747 Series Aeroplanes
AD/B747/249
Appendix A
Engine Thrust Control Cables 7/2001
INSPECTION PROCEDURE
- Detailed Visual Inspection to Detect Wear
(a) Perform a detailed visual inspection of the engine thrust control cables in the area of the plate to detect wear.
(b) Replace the cable assembly if any of the following criteria are met:
(i) One cable strand had worn wires where one wire cross section is decreased by more than 40 percent (see Figure 1)
(ii) A kink is found
(iii) Corrosion is found.
2. Inspection to Detect Broken Wires
(a) To check for broken wires, rub a cloth along the length of the cable. The cloth catches on broken wires.
(b) Replace the cable assembly if any of the following criteria are met.
(i) Replace the 7x7 cable assembly if there are two or more broken wires anywhere in the total cable assembly.
(ii) Replace the 7x19 cable assembly if there are four or more broken wires in 12 continuous inches of cable or there are six or more broken wires anywhere in the total cable assembly.

Overview
The Civil Aviation Regulations 1998, as amended through the legislative instrument F2006B03147, were enacted to address safety concerns associated with the operation of Boeing 747 series aeroplanes, specifically targeting engine thrust control cables. This legislative instrument was introduced to mitigate risks posed by wear, corrosion, and broken wires in the engine thrust control cables, which could compromise the structural integrity and safe operation of the aircraft. The enacting body, the Parliament of the Commonwealth of Australia, aimed to ensure the highest standards of aviation safety through these regulations, thereby protecting passengers, crew, and the general public. The overarching policy objective was to mandate rigorous inspection and maintenance protocols to prevent in-flight failures that could lead to catastrophic outcomes.

Key Provisions
The main operative sections of the Civil Aviation Regulations 1998, Part 39 - 105 Civil Aviation Safety Authority Schedule of Airworthiness Directives for Boeing 747 Series Aeroplanes, particularly AD/B747/249 Appendix A, focus on the inspection and replacement of engine thrust control cables. Section (a) under the inspection procedure mandates a detailed visual inspection of the engine thrust control cables to detect wear (105.001). If any cable strand has worn wires where the wire cross-section is decreased by more than 40 percent, if a kink is found, or if there is any evidence of corrosion, the cable assembly must be replaced (105.002). Additionally, section (b) outlines the procedure for inspecting the cables to detect broken wires. If two or more broken wires are detected in a 7x7 cable assembly, or if four or more broken wires are found in 12 continuous inches of a 7x19 cable assembly, or if six or more broken wires are found anywhere in the total cable assembly, the cable must be replaced (105.003).
